Tôi chạy Magento 1.9.2.2 và tôi muốn chuyển sang php 7.0.
Có thể và lưu để chuyển sang 7.0 với cài đặt Magento này không?
Tôi chạy Magento 1.9.2.2 và tôi muốn chuyển sang php 7.0.
Có thể và lưu để chuyển sang 7.0 với cài đặt Magento này không?
Câu trả lời:
Có, có thể di chuyển 1.9.2.2 từ PHP 5.5 sang PHP 7. Chưa được hỗ trợ chính thức nhưng Inchoo đã tìm ra giải pháp cho việc này.
Họ đã phát triển phần mở rộng Magento để làm cho Magento tương thích với PHP 7.
http://inchoo.net/magento/its-alive/
Tính đến thời điểm hiện tại, Magento 1.9.3.7 PHP 7.0 và 7.1 đã được hỗ trợ chính thức. Hỗ trợ PHP 7.2 chưa chính thức cho cả Magento 1 và 2.
Cảm ơn bạn
Câu trả lời ngắn gọn là không, nó không. Magento CE 1.9.2.4 chỉ hỗ trợ PHP 5.4 và 5.5 chính thức. Và trong khi PHP 5.6 chạy tốt, nó bão hòa các tệp nhật ký với vô số thông điệp cảnh báo.
Câu trả lời dài là việc sửa đổi nó để hỗ trợ PHP7 tương đối dễ dàng. Tuy nhiên, nhiều tiện ích mở rộng vẫn không tương thích với PHP7, do đó, phần lớn bạn chỉ có một mình .
Magento đã phát hành bản vá PHP 7.2 chính thức cho Magento 1 (tháng 9 năm 2018), điều đó có nghĩa là không cần mở rộng inchoo nữa !! nếu bạn đã cài đặt nó: Gỡ bỏ mô-đun này khỏi cửa hàng M1 của bạn và sử dụng bản vá chính thức.
Tuy nhiên, bạn sẽ cần phải vá cửa hàng của bạn. Nó đòi hỏi các bản vá bảo mật trước đó phải được áp dụng trước khi cài đặt. Các yêu cầu đầy đủ được liệt kê trên tải về.